My Thoughts: Protect My Heart has the characters falling hard and fast, but with Mia’s plan to move across the country any day they say goodbye. A few months later when Mia finds out she’s pregnant, it turns out to not be that simple. The characters are both very likable but it’s simply a problem of right person, wrong hometown location. The pace of the story is very quick and it remains relatively low angst/drama. I felt like we didn’t really get to ever feel Mia coming to terms with being pregnant, just Jason adjusting to being a dad. This story fits in accidental pregnancy, small town vibes, some fake dating and forced proximity. If these tropes are favorites of yours, and you are looking for a light/fast read then I would recommend it. In My Own Words: Two strangers meet at a wedding. They agree to partner up. One thing leads to another. After one wonderful night, they part ways. Four months later, they do more than talk.
My Final Say: This was a straightforward, light and tame romance with a "he falls first" hardline. It was very linear, in terms of a narrative style. It was family rich and included multiple storylines that introduced other characters and couplings. Overall, it was a solid read.
